How to migrate instance in ibm BPM?
IBM® Business Process Manager offers two ways to migrate process instances:
- While the snapshot is being installed, select Migrate.
- Use the Migrate Inflight Data option after a snapshot is installed.
What happens when an instance migrates from one snapshot to another and there is an activity in the old snapshot that contains a token but the activity does not exist in the new snapshot?
Orphan tokens occur when an instance migrates from one snapshot to another and there is an activity in the old snapshot that contains a token but the activity does not exist in the new snapshot.

Can we migrate running the BPM version?
You can migrate your IBM® Business Process Manager V8. 5.7 environment, including applications and running instances, to the same version running on new hardware. Important: The time zone of the IBM BPM and database servers in the new system must match the time zone of the old system.
How do I delete a snapshot in IBM BPM?
Using the Process Admin Console
- Click Server Admin > Workflow Admin > Health Management.
- Select the command Delete Snapshots.
- Specify values for the command’s parameters.
- Click Submit.
- If there is an error, you will see the error message. Otherwise, you can check the progress of the deletion in the system log.

What is snapshot in IBM BPM?
Snapshots record the state of items within a workflow project at a specific point in time. You can create snapshots in the Workflow Center console or in IBM® Process Designer. Snapshot management, such as installing, exporting, and archiving, is performed in the Workflow Center console.
What is needed for data migration?
Data migration includes data profiling, data cleansing, data validation, and the ongoing data quality assurance process in the target system. To convert it, data must be extracted from the source, altered, and loaded into the new target system based on a set of requirements.
